Subject: Quickstore 4.2 — bloom filter now fronts the KV layer

Plugin authors: starting with this release, Quickstore places a bloom filter ahead of the key-value store. Negative lookups return faster; false positives fall through safely. No API changes are required on your side. Verify your plugin against the staging build referenced below.

session token of fahif-tadup = htk3_9c7

Runbook: account recovery — retrying failed exports

When a Tidemark customer's data export fails during account recovery, check the export queue first. Requeue jobs stuck over 30 minutes; do not requeue more than twice. If the third attempt fails, escalate to the Exports pod. To unlock the recovery console for a manual retry, use the passphrase below.

unlock words, hahip-baduf: holwyn-istath-julvan

## Reviewing the retention sweeper

Quick context before you review Brindlevault PRs: the data-retention sweeper runs hourly and hard-deletes anything past its policy window, so be picky about off-by-one date math. To run the sweeper locally against the scratch store, your env file needs the following line:

sealed setting: LEDGER_TOKEN13=5d842615a26d7